Ledges is one of my favorites in the area and it's right in York. http://ledgesgolf.com/

Not a fan of "Old Marsh" (Wells).

Depending on how far you're willing to travel - I'd also recommend:

to the north

Biddeford +Saco (Donald Ross design)

Cape Arundel (known for Pres Bush playing there).

to the south just across the boarder into NH

Portsmouth C.C. is real nice course although a bit pricy and semi-private so limited hours for non-members.

Breakfast Hill and even Pease is a nice layout (although more blue collar).

I played the Ledge years ago, can you elaborate on how walkable the course is? I am playing there this week and would love to walk if the course is set up for it (not that is just allows it...) Thanks!

Link to comment
Share on other sites

I walk it 95% of the time. Some of the comments that I get are about the long distances between greens and tees, I say who cares, distance isn't the issue, it's the hills. With that stated, The Ledges has about 4 moderate hills and 6 tough hills.

Moderate

6th green to 7th tee

12th tee to to 12th fairway

12th green to the 13th tee

4th tee to 4th fairway

 

Tough

2nd green to 3rd tee.

3rd approach to the 3rd green.

And the worst, the entire 13th hole.

18th approach to 18th green

18th green to the clubhouse.

The concept of "tough" and "moderate" hills is very relative. For me coming from farther north, none of the hills at the Ledges is really all that tough. Links at Outlook has a couple of good hills on the back nine - but I don't find the rest of the courses near the coast having much in the way of hills worth mentioning. But that's just me - it all depends what you're used to. e.g. for someone coming from many Florida courses, they all might be tough.

 

And for me, the long distances between greens and tees (like at old marsh) is more an annoyance from the perspective of the time it takes than from the effort.
